Transaction c807902a11f70daea4a1432a51de348e9ec5674ffc6dffb5a0124af5c753ad69

25 Input
1 Outputs
  • c807902a11f70daea4a1432a51de348e9ec5674ffc6dffb5a0124af5c753ad69:0
  • value  963114
    address  3B4yrU15yMnbhX1oh7oKnoyLcRAkqviCGw